What went wrong for USC this year? The easy answer is "just about everything."

The second is to point to the UCLA game last year -- a 50-0 Trojans win -- and this year -- a 38-28 Trojans loss. Both USC and UCLA welcomed back a lot of returning starters for 2012: The Trojans 19, the Bruins 16. So the teams weren't substantially different from 2011. A significant number of guys played in both games, only to very different conclusions.
